Maximize Your Professional Growth with Effective Networking Strategies

Networking Event

Networking is a crucial aspect of professional growth that can open doors to new opportunities, collaborations, and knowledge sharing. Whether you are a seasoned professional or just starting in your career, honing your networking skills can significantly impact your success. Here are some effective strategies to help you make the most out of your networking efforts:

1. Attend Industry Events and Conferences

Industry events and conferences are excellent opportunities to meet like-minded professionals, learn about the latest trends, and expand your network. Be proactive in engaging with attendees, exchanging contact information, and following up after the event.

2. Join Professional Associations

Professional associations offer a platform to connect with peers in your industry, access resources, and stay updated on industry developments. Take an active role in association activities, such as attending meetings, volunteering, or joining committees.

3. Utilize Online Networking Platforms

Platforms like LinkedIn provide a virtual space to connect with professionals worldwide, showcase your expertise, and engage in industry discussions. Build a strong profile, consistently share valuable content, and interact with your connections to expand your online network.

4. Attend Workshops and Training Sessions

Participating in workshops and training sessions not only enhances your skills but also allows you to meet professionals with similar interests. Take advantage of these opportunities to learn from experts, share your knowledge, and build valuable relationships.

5. Leverage Informational Interviews

Conducting informational interviews with professionals in your field can provide insights into different career paths, industry trends, and valuable advice. Approach professionals respectfully, prepare thoughtful questions, and express gratitude for their time and expertise.

By incorporating these networking strategies into your professional development plan, you can establish meaningful connections, stay informed about industry developments, and create opportunities for career growth. Remember, networking is not just about exchanging business cards but building authentic relationships that can benefit both parties in the long run.

Invest time and effort in nurturing your network, and you'll see the positive impact it can have on your professional journey.
